Lines Matching refs:konepure
82 struct roccat_common2_device *konepure; in konepure_init_specials() local
91 konepure = kzalloc(sizeof(*konepure), GFP_KERNEL); in konepure_init_specials()
92 if (!konepure) { in konepure_init_specials()
96 hid_set_drvdata(hdev, konepure); in konepure_init_specials()
98 retval = roccat_common2_device_init_struct(usb_dev, konepure); in konepure_init_specials()
109 konepure->chrdev_minor = retval; in konepure_init_specials()
110 konepure->roccat_claimed = 1; in konepure_init_specials()
115 kfree(konepure); in konepure_init_specials()
122 struct roccat_common2_device *konepure; in konepure_remove_specials() local
128 konepure = hid_get_drvdata(hdev); in konepure_remove_specials()
129 if (konepure->roccat_claimed) in konepure_remove_specials()
130 roccat_disconnect(konepure->chrdev_minor); in konepure_remove_specials()
131 kfree(konepure); in konepure_remove_specials()
178 struct roccat_common2_device *konepure = hid_get_drvdata(hdev); in konepure_raw_event() local
187 if (konepure != NULL && konepure->roccat_claimed) in konepure_raw_event()
188 roccat_report_event(konepure->chrdev_minor, data); in konepure_raw_event()